Track This Job
Add this job to your tracking list to:
- Monitor application status and updates
 - Change status (Applied, Interview, Offer, etc.)
 - Add personal notes and comments
 - Set reminders for follow-ups
 - Track your entire application journey
 
Save This Job
Add this job to your saved collection to:
- Access easily from your saved jobs dashboard
 - Review job details later without searching again
 - Compare with other saved opportunities
 - Keep a collection of interesting positions
 - Receive notifications about saved jobs before they expire
 
AI-Powered Job Summary
Get a concise overview of key job requirements, responsibilities, and qualifications in seconds.
Pro Tip: Use this feature to quickly decide if a job matches your skills before reading the full description.
The company is growing rapidly and it's an exciting time to join, having secured $12M in Series B funding in January 2023. In just four years, it has gone from two co-founders to a team of 100+ staff, with offices in London and Paris. At Landytech, we see diversity as our strength with a team from over 15 countries and 14 languages spoken.
Team & Role
We're seeking a talented Software Engineer to join our team. You'll build and maintain services and tools (written primarily in Python) that process and publish financial metrics, directly impacting how our customers access and utilize critical financial data.
This is an excellent opportunity for engineers with strong fundamentals to develop their expertise in a finance-focused environment using modern technologies. We welcome candidates at all experience levels - whether you're early in your career and eager to learn, or a seasoned engineer seeking hands-on technical work in the fintech domain.
Key Responsibilities
- Develop and maintain robust APIs for processing and publishing financial metrics
 - Write clean, efficient, and well-documented code
 - Collaborate with the team to design scalable solutions for financial data pipelines
 - Participate in code reviews and contribute to engineering best practices
 - Debug and optimize existing systems for performance and reliability
 - Work closely with stakeholders to understand requirements and deliver solutions
 
- Solid understanding of data structures, algorithms, and software design principles
 - Good knowledge of Python and object-oriented programming principles
 - Understanding of relational databases and database design fundamentals
 - Familiarity with unit testing and integration testing practices Comfortable working collaboratively in a team environments
 
- Experience with low-level programming languages (Rust, C++)
 - Financial domain knowledge: understanding of financial concepts, metrics, or fintech/finance experience
 - Experience building data pipelines, ETL processes, or handling large-scale data
 -  Familiarity with modern data processing libraries (NumPy, Polars, DuckDB)
 
- Beyond the technical requirements, we value engineers who:
 - Are self-motivated and eager to learn and expand their skills
 - Possess an analytical mindset with strong attention to detail
 - Take pride in writing maintainable, well-tested code
 - Are excited about working at the intersection of technology and finance
 - Bring fresh perspectives and ideas to the team
 
- An opportunity to work in a fast growing fintech revolutionizing investment reporting
 - Hybrid style of work/WFH allowed depending on role
 - Competitive salary & stock options package
 - Private medical insurance with Bupa for you and your family members
 - Life insurance option
 - Pension Plan with NEST
 - Cycle to Work Scheme and gym allowance
 - Office food & drinks, regular socials
 
Key Skills
Ranked by relevanceReady to apply?
Join Landytech and take your career to the next level!
Application takes less than 5 minutes

